First season of “No cover”, hit paradeThe first-ever music competition TV show will air on Wednesday, April 20. A trailer is available below.

Alice Cooper, Bishop Briggs, Gavin Rossdale, Lzzy Hale and Tosin Abasi served as judges to help find the world’s next greatest unsigned original artist.

While most music competitions such as “American Idol” and “The voice” encourage musicians to cover other people’s songs, “No cover” spotlights artists and bands who write and record their own original music. The entire first season was filmed last year at the legendary Troubadour in West Hollywood, California. Since 1957, Le Troubadour has been at the forefront of musical discovery. From the first years of Bob Dylan, Neil Young, Joni Mitchell and EAGLES in the American beginnings of Elton Johnthe first title in Los Angeles of METALLIC and the beginnings of “Appetite for Destruction” range GUNS N’ ROSES.

Rock and Roll Hall of Fame Alice Cooper is widely known as the original “shock rocker” with a hugely successful career in music spanning an incredible six decades. His hit songs “School is over”, “No More Mister Nice Guy” and “Poison” are staples of rock radio and his iconic appearances in films like “Wayne’s World” and “Dark Shadows” endeared him to generations of fans.

As singer, guitarist, songwriter and founder of an iconic multi-platinum rock band BUSH, Rossdale has sold over 20 million records in the United States and Canada alone. BUSH compiled an incredible streak of 23 consecutive Top 40 singles on the Modern Rock and Mainstream Rock charts. Eleven of them reached the Top 5, including six in first place: “Descend”, “Glycerine”, “Machine Head”, “Swallowed”, “The Chemicals Between Us” and “The Sound of Winter”. BUSH released their eighth studio album, “The kingdom”in 2020.
